It is common for pregnant women to suffer from hemorrhoids during the second and third trimesters. This is caused by having more pressure on their blood vessels in the pelvic region. The strain of labor can make the hemorrhoids even worse. The information contained in this article will help to prevent the development of hemorrhoids and how to treat them if they do occur.

If you’re looking to a long-term solution to your hemorrhoids, try adding more fiber to your diet. You should eat whole grain foods, pasta, oatmeal and a lot of leafy green vegetables. A diet high in fiber will improve bowel motility, which means you’re less likely to suffer the kind of strain that can cause hemorrhoids.

Keep your hemorrhoids as clean if you currently suffer from hemorrhoids. Use wet wipes to clean up instead of toilet paper. A sitz bath that’s warm can soothe swelling and pain from swollen veins. Soak in it for about 20 minutes or more.

One risk factor for hemorrhoids is straining too hard during a bowel movement. Eating healthier foods and downing plenty of water will allow the stools to come out easier. Squatting could also aids the process and reduces the need to strain during a bowel movement. Use a small stool that is placed underneath of your feet when you are defecating. Hemorrhoids are not a common in countries where the people squat instead of sitting.

To relieve your hemorrhoids, try taking Rutin. One possible cause of hemorrhoids is weakened blood vessels. Rutin facilitates proper Vitamin C absorption, and is a flavonoid able to help make blood vessels stronger. The best foods to eat for rutin are leafy greens, onions, and citrus fruits. If you take rutin as a supplement, then you want to take around 500mg a day.

Understanding hemorrhoids are is a big part of learning to manage them. Hemorrhoids are bundles of varicose veins that specifically appear in the anal region.

Witch hazel is very effective in alleviating the pain caused by hemorrhoids. Witch hazel has astringent properties that will shrink the hemorrhoid tissues, which will promote healing. Gently rub some witch hazel onto your hemorrhoids with a delicate cotton ball. Allow it to sit on your skin for about 10 minutes.

A common cause of hemorrhoids is overexerting muscles in the area of the sphincter.If you suffer from recurring hemorrhoids, it may be possible that some element of your lifestyle is to blame; pay careful attention not to put too much force behind certain daily activities.

When battling hemorrhoids, you should be careful not to expose the irritated and inflamed tissues to any sanitary products which may have fragrances, essential oils or dyes in them. Even short term exposure to products containing these additives can cause pain, itching or swelling of the hemorrhoids.

Losing weight is a great way to reduce hemorrhoid condition easier. Being overweight can contribute to hemorrhoid issues. Take care not to use laxatives too frequently, either for weight loss or hemorrhoid treatment, since continually doing this is eventually unhealthy.

If you find yourself getting hemorrhoids frequently, make sure that you’re drinking all the water you need. Your stools will be softer if you are hydrated. Things to avoid are excessive consumption of caffeinated beverages and alcohol.

Frequent heavy lifting is a little-known potential cause of hemorrhoids. Your body is subjected to the same stress when lifting heavy objects as it is when you forcefully strain to have a bowel movement. If you are frequently troubled by hemorrhoids, stay away from heavy lifting in general, even between flare ups.

Scratching can cause damage and even infection in the area where skin has been damaged by scratching. If the area is just too annoying and you find yourself needing to scratch for relief, pat the area with a wet cloth to cleanse it. The feeling of itchiness may be from not having the area clean, so patting using a wet cloth can help clean it and relieve some itching.

Consume fiber-rich foods, and drink plenty of water in order to soften feces. Softer stools can relieve or prevent hemorrhoids because there won’t be as much strain. There are many different foods you can try here. Nuts and seeds, corn, grapes, watermelon and many other food sources will help soften your stool. There are some fiber-rich vegetables, such as okra and cabbage, that can help too. To see the full effects of these foods, make sure you drink lots of water.
